Chillz99 t1_jea0yhh wrote
Reply to What happened on 376 yesterday morning? by WuKongPhooey
the accident caused a fuel spill from one of the trucks which required a fuel spill truck from the city of Pittsburgh, so it took a while to clean it up. Also had to remove the fuel from the tanks remaining on the damaged trucks so they could be towed.

cpr4life8 t1_jea0ti5 wrote
Reply to comment by WuKongPhooey in What happened on 376 yesterday morning? by WuKongPhooey
I moved to Pittsburgh from another state in 2016. I quickly learned that 376 is not a term locals use and will look at you like a dog hearing something only dogs can hear when you say it 😅 376 west of the city is Parkway West. 376 east of the city is Parkway East.
